Consistent with clinical samples, national sample findings revealed that:

a. controlling for age, ethnicity, and parental education, women with histories of childhood sexual abuse were less likely to report recent alcohol use
b. without controlling for age, ethnicity, and parental education, women with histories of childhood sexual abuse were more likely to report recent alcohol use
c. controlling for age, ethnicity, and parental education, women with histories of childhood sexual abuse were more likely to report recent alcohol use
d. without controlling for age, ethnicity, and parental education, women with histories of childhood sexual abuse were less likely to report recent alcohol use


Ans: C
